    This wonderful old quilt was donated to our food and clothing pantry and rescued by the director, who is a wonderful quilter. She has very little time, so I offered to try to fix the worn spots. I appliqued over the worn places and repaired seams that had come apart, using vintage feed sack fabric I had and some repro fabrics my friend had. It looked to be machine pieced and hand quilted. Even though the hand quilting stitches aren't tiny, they are even. I'm selling it on eBay to donate the proceeds to the pantry, which gives away food and clothing to anyone who needs it. I wish it could tell its story.
